Description:
The post holder will be responsible for their own daily workload with supervision and support from the HUB Clinical Operations Managers, Senior Triage Clinicians and wider Triage and Allocation Team. You will be expected to have excellent communication skills & IT skills and be able to provide evidence of working successfully at Band 3 and above. The post holder will need to show their experience of contributing to assessments and care planning and carrying out interventions to contribute to patient health and wellbeing. Please see job description for necessary qualifications & experience required.
The post holder will have access to training and supervision that will build upon their skills and will help them to progress as a competent band 4 AP. The post holder will need to be a car driver with a full current driving licence
